“The View” co-host Sunny Hostin is dismayed at a poll that found white suburban women favoring the Republican Party.

On Thursday, Hostin said, “I read a poll just yesterday that white Republican suburban women are now going to vote Republican.”

“It’s almost like roaches voting for Raid,” she added.

Conservative co-host Alyssa Farah-Griffin chimed in as she tried to push back on the comparison.

But Hostin pressed on, “They’re voting against their own self-interest. Do they want to live in Gilead? Do they want to live in ‘The Handmaid’s Tale’?”

Finally, Griffin responded, “Do we love democracy or not? Because it’s insulting to the voter. People make up decisions on what’s right for their family.”

Co-host Joy Behar added, “You’re not voting for Republicans. You’re voting for a cult. Remember that. It’s a cult. It’s not Republicans anymore.”

Hostin appeared to be referring to a poll released by The Wall Street Journal, which found white suburban women now say they favor Republicans over Democrats by 15 percentage points — marking a 27 percentage point swing in support from August.

This is not the first time the co-host has expressed exasperation at a certain demographic possibly voting for Republicans.

In September, she told her fellow panelists it is “so interesting to me that there are so many Latinos that vote Republican because they vote against their own self-interest.”

Hostin’s comments come as polls have repeatedly found voters say inflation is a top concern for voters.

Perhaps she believes access to abortion is in voters’ self-interest.

But in the end, it’s up to each voter to decide what is best for them. And for anyone to make a blanket statement implying they really know what is in one demographic’s best interests is insulting.
